Born on March 19, 1955, in Idar-Oberstein, West Germany, this actor’s path to success was not without its challenges. His mother, a German factory worker, and his father, an American soldier, shaped his upbringing, instilling in him a resilience and determination that would later propel him to the heights of Hollywood fame.

Acting became his true passion early on, and in the 1980s, he achieved widespread recognition with his iconic role in the TV series “Moonlighting.” His subsequent performances in films like “Die Hard” and “The Sixth Sense” cemented his status as a highly sought-after and respected actor, captivating audiences with his magnetic on-screen presence.
